Introduction to Parrots
Parrots come from the order Psittaciformes and are defined by their curved beaks, strong legs, Graupapagei Zucht (brycefoster.com) and zygodactyl feet, which means they have two toes facing forward and African Grey Parrot For Sale two backward. This distinct foot structure enables them to grasp and control items with amazing dexterity. Parrots are extremely social animals that thrive on interaction, whether with their human buddies or other birds.

Natural Habitat
Parrots are belonging to tropical and subtropical regions worldwide, mainly in Central and South America, Australia, and parts of Africa and Asia. They flourish in a range of environments, consisting of rainforests, savannas, and forests, where they can find abundant food sources such as fruits, seeds, and nuts.
Habitat CharacteristicsTrees: Parrots often nest in tree cavities and invest a substantial amount of their time in the canopy, where food is numerous.Social Structures: Many types are understood to reside in flocks, which offers security in numbers and enhances social interaction.Migration Patterns: Some parrot types migrate seasonally to gain access to food sources, especially in locations where resources change with the weather condition.4. Feeding Parrots
A healthy diet plan is essential for preserving a parrot's health. Their diet plan should include a variety of foods, consisting of pellets specially formulated for parrots, fresh fruits, and vegetables.
Table 3: Recommended FoodsFood TypeExamplesPelletsNutritionally well balanced parrot pelletsFruitsApples, bananas, berries, melonsVeggiesCarrots, broccoli, spinach, bell peppersNuts (in small amounts)Almonds, walnuts, pecans7. Health Care
Routine health checks and a proper diet are important for preserving a parrot's health. Typical health concerns amongst parrots consist of:
Feather Plucking: Often an indication of tension or dullness.Respiratory Issues: Symptoms might consist of wheezing or sleepiness.Weight problems: Can arise from an improper diet plan and absence of workout.
It is a good idea to consult a bird veterinarian if any health concerns develop.
